<?xml version="1.0" standalone="yes"?> <Paper uid="C96-1060"> <Title>The discourse functions of Italian subjects: a centering approach</Title> <Section position="2" start_page="0" end_page="0" type="abstr"> <SectionTitle> Abstract </SectionTitle> <Paragraph position="0"> This paper examines the discourse fluictions that different types of subjects perform in Italian within the centering framework (Grosz el; al., 1995). I build on my previous work (Di gugenio, 1990) that accounted for the alternation of null and strong prottouns in subject position.</Paragraph> <Paragraph position="1"> I extend my previous atialysis in several wws: for examI)le, I refine the notion of CONTINUE altd discuss the centering functions of full NPs.</Paragraph> </Section> class="xml-element"></Paper>
